Meet the real-life inspiration behind the Kraken

Is the Kraken just a myth made up by sailors, or is there some truth to the tale? Turns out to be the latter, as giant squids have roamed the seven seas for a vast many years. For more fun animal facts, check out Animalogic on YouTube.

